View Diamox Tablet (strip of 15 tablets) uses, composition, side-effects, price, substitutes, drug interactions, … WebMar 19, 2024 · The Most Common:: Carbonated drinks taste awful for many on Diamox (acetazolamide) which can be a surprise if you are a dedicated soda pop fan; beer becomes dreadful as well. Foods may also become either bitter or oddly bland though this side …

Diamox (Acetazolamide) is used for the prevention or lessening of symptoms related to mountain sickness in climbers attempting rapid ascent and in those experiencing mountain sickness despite gradual ascent. ... Many travelers report that carbonated beverages taste flat while they take Diamox. Adverse reactions ...
